For tough cards like this one, I always recommend small but powerful plays, i.e. I'd favor playing six separate straight $10 tri's than playing one large box for the same $60.  Play our selections or the ones you like, but keep your play "small/powerful".  Just one "small/powerful" win ticket will make for a very nice day.
